Finderのウインドウを、決めた大きさで、毎回、開きたい

アイコンが横5 X 縦6=30個の見える大きさで、使っています。

ユーザがアップロードしたファイル


今までは、新規ウインドウを開く時、2つ目以降のウインドウを開く時、

同じ大きさのウインドウが開いていたのですが、



最近、横4 X 縦3=12個の見える大きさが、出てくることがあります。

(これがデフォルトのサイズでしょうか?)

ユーザがアップロードしたファイル


意図しない時に、この小さなウインドウで開いてくるので、いちいち、サイズを直すことが、たびたびです。


表示オプションで設定出来るものは設定して、「デフォルトとして使用」を押していますが、


ウインドウサイズは、ここでは設定できないようですね。


以前の、YosemiteやSierraの時も、たま〜になら、同様のこと、有ったように思いますが、

最近は、毎日のように、大きさを直さなくてはならないです。


Finderの環境設定には、無いようですし、

Finderのメニューバーのどこにも、それらしき操作は、私には見つけられませんでした。

システム環境設定でも、同じでした。



どこで、ウインドウサイズを、好みの大きさに決める設定を、

出来るのでしょうか?

それとも、

出来ないのでしょうか?



ご存知でしたら、お教えいただけないでしょうか?

よろしくお願いいたします。


Mac OS 10.13.4(17E199)

Finder 10.13.5



ーーーーーーーーーー

T22T 様

おかげさまで、このように、Pagesにシャープな画像を読み込めて、

編集した上で、画像を書き出すこと出来ました。

教えていただき、助かりました。ほんとうに、ありがとうございましたm(_ _)m

MacBook Air, macOS High Sierra (10.13.4)

投稿日 2018/04/19 04:01

返信
スレッドに付いたマーク ランキングトップの返信

投稿日 2018/04/20 00:02

いつもタブを開いているので忘れていましたが、.DS_Storeのせいかもしれませんね。.DS_Storeがある場合、そこに保存されているWindowBoundsでウインドウが開かれます。


Terminal.appから次のコマンドを実行すれば、~/.DS_Storeを除き、~/配下の全ての.DS_Storeを消すことができます。


find $HOME -name ".DS_Store" -mindepth 2 -delete


ただ、新規ウインドウを開いたとき、うっかり移動やリサイズをしてしまうと、そのフォルダーに.DS_Storeが再び作られ、WindowBoundsが記録されてしまいます。これを避けるには、タブで運用するのがいいでしょう。

ユーザがアップロードしたファイル

返信: 54

2018/04/24 12:11 kai_markII への返信

スカイブルー193様


はじめまして。こんばんは。

すいません!!!携帯を悪戯していた者がなんかメールの返信をしてしまったみたいで、わけの解らない投稿を申し訳ございませんでした。大変失礼しました。


経緯等全く読んでおりませんが、詳しい方々がアドバイスされている様なのでがんばってください。

本当に大変申し訳ございませんでした。失礼します。

2018/04/19 05:22 hohokihai への返信

hohokihai 様

ご返信ありがとうございます。


そのように、今までは、使ってきましたし、そのようになっておりましたが

それでも、

最近は、意図しない時に、前掲の画像の「小さい方のウインドウ」で、開いてくることがあるということなのです。

ーーーーーーーーーー

~/Library/Preferences/com.apple.finder

は、見当たりませんでした。


/Library/Preferences/com.apple.FindMyMac.plist

なら、ありました。

2018/04/19 16:51 onesize への返信

onesize 様

ご返信ありがとうございます。


丁寧にご説明をくださり、ありがとうございます。

だいぶ、分かること出来ました。


そこに記載されていることをお示しくださったということだったのですね。

見なければいけないと、思ってしまいました。失礼をいたしました。


クイックルックで見てみました。

私には、何が何やらの文字の羅列にしか見えませんが、このどこかに、

Finder ウインドウについて決めた、サイズ、位置などが、記載されているということですね。

ただ、これらは、先に、プレビュー、カラム表示にて、見ることは、出来てはいたのですが・・・

内容を理解は、全く、出来ませんが・・・

「/Users/ユーザー名/Library/Preferences/com.apple.finder.plist」を、ダブルクリックしても開けません。

「/Users/ユーザー名/Library/Preferences/com.apple.finder.plist」を「情報を見る」してみると、

「このアプリケーションで開く:LadioCast.app(デフォルト)」になってます。


おっしゃる通り、カラム表示で見ると、

中を見れるようですが、

「com.apple.finder.plist」のアイコンをcomamnd+Iでの「情報を見る」のプレビューにあるものと、同じものが、見れるだけなのですが。


● 情報を見るのプレビュー

ユーザがアップロードしたファイル


● カラム表示

ユーザがアップロードしたファイル


● クイックルック

ユーザがアップロードしたファイル


まぁ、

そこにあることを知っておく」ということまでで、今回は、詰めないでも十分と思います。


「plist」は、私が手を出すには、まだ早そうです^^;



そして、現状では、

決めたサイズと違うサイズが、出ることは、そういうものと受け取るということで、了解しました。



いろいろと、ありがとうございました。

お導き、感謝いたします。


Macを知るという旅は、私には、果てしなく遠いもの(きっと届かない)に、見えています。

みなさん、すごいですね。よくそこまで理解なさっていらっしゃるのですね。リスペクトです。

(みなさんの近くまで、進めるとしても、私には、相当先の話ですね。)

2018/04/21 02:17 hohokihai への返信

hohokihai 様

ご返信ありがとうございます。


未熟者ゆえ、右往左往してしまい、かえって、ご心配をおかけしてしまい、まことに、すみません。


とりあえず、「defaults read com.apple.finder ReopenState | grep WindowBounds | sed 's/^ *//'」コマンドを打ってみました。


Last login: Sat Apr 21 16:49:34 on ttys000

わたしのMacBook-Air:~ ユーザ名$ defaults read com.apple.finder ReopenState | grep WindowBounds | sed 's/^ *//'

2018-04-21 16:51:43.291 defaults[949:27989]

The domain/default pair of (com.apple.finder, ReopenState) does not exist


hohokihai さんの画像のような、WindowBoundsの座標軸の数値は、表示されませんでした。


コマンドを調べると、

「defaults」「read」は、コマンド集では、検索できませんでした。

「grep」は、「テキストファイル中から、正規表現に一致する行を検索して出力する。」

「sed」は、「文字列の置換・削除などの編集を行う」


雑な類推ですが、

「com.apple.finder ReopenState」の中から、「WindowBounds」を正規表現に一致する行を検索して出力させるが、その時に、「's/^ *//'」の文字列の置換・削除などの編集を行え。ということを、させようとするコマンドで、合っていますか?


ちなみに、

「defaults」「read」「's/^ *//'」は、何でしょうか?

また、

2018-04-21 16:51:43.291 defaults[949:27989]

これは、何を指しているのでしょうか?



The domain/default pair of (com.apple.finder, ReopenState) does not exist

英語全然ダメなので、こちらも雑な類推ですが、


「exist」が、存在する、生存するって意味のようなので、

『「com.apple.finder」「ReopenState」が、無い』という意味ですかね?


(「pair of」なので、「一緒に? 中に? 揃って?」みたいなことでしょうか。)



そこで、スレを読み直すと、onesize さんのコメントの中に、以下の文章がありました。


私は、Finderのウィンドウサイズの変更はしてないので、ReopenStateは"com.apple.finder.plist"にはなかったのですが、


ReopenStateはないけれど、WindowBoundsはあるのでそれから推測すると、WindowBoundsの値が{{335, 331}, {770, 437}}のようになっている(座標軸とそこからのピクセル数なはず)ので、


つまり、私のMBAにも、「ReopenState」は、無いということでしょうか?





ーーーーーーーーーー

「WindowBoundsの設定」のほうは、こんな感じです。


Last login: Sat Apr 21 16:51:27 on ttys000

わたしのMacBook-Air:~ ユーザ名$ defaults read com.apple.finder ComputerViewSettings | grep WindowBounds | sed 's/^ *//'

WindowBounds = "{{582, 127}, {770, 750}}";

この結果は、どのようにご覧になりますか?


ーーーーーーーーーー

この2つのコマンドは、hohokihai さんの画像を見ると、どちらも、座標軸の数値を表示させているように見えます。

座標の数値は同じに見えますが、「違う座標」を、表示させているのでしょうか?


それとも、同じ座標なのでしょうか?

それならば、

2つのコマンドで、同じ座標軸の数値を探すのは、「なぜ」でしょうか?



お手数をお掛けいたします。

よろしくお願いいたします。

2018/05/10 17:08 スカイブルー193 への返信

私の環境下では、com.apple.finder.plistにWindowBoundsは7つ見つかりました。

これは、"defaults read com.apple.finder | grep WindowBounds"で確認できます。

その結果が下記です。


onesize$ defaults read com.apple.finder | grep WindowBounds

WindowBounds = "{{335, 331}, {770, 436}}";

WindowBounds = "{{321, 341}, {770, 436}}";

WindowBounds = "{{352, 238}, {770, 460}}";

WindowBounds = "{{335, 331}, {770, 437}}";

WindowBounds = "{{427, 216}, {770, 436}}";

WindowBounds = "{{469, 235}, {770, 436}}";

WindowBounds = "{{454, 0}, {770, 437}}";


この中で、数値に変動があったのはゴミ箱のウィンドウだけでした。ゴミ箱のウィンドウをを画面右下に移動して、再度確認すると、

onesize$ defaults read com.apple.finder | grep WindowBounds

WindowBounds = "{{335, 331}, {770, 436}}";

WindowBounds = "{{321, 341}, {770, 436}}";

WindowBounds = "{{352, 238}, {770, 460}}";

WindowBounds = "{{335, 331}, {770, 437}}";

WindowBounds = "{{427, 216}, {770, 436}}";

WindowBounds = "{{469, 235}, {770, 436}}";

WindowBounds = "{{0, 0}, {770, 437}}";

となり、移動後の座標軸が記録されていて、再度ゴミ箱を開くと同じ位置で表示されます。

しかし、他のフォルダもファインダで開き、移動後に再度開く時は同じ位置で表示されるので、この値は別のところに保存されているようです。

2018/04/21 23:08 スカイブルー193 への返信

ただ、「ReopenState」は、無いのでしょうが、「WindowBounds」の文字も見つけられませんでした。

見落としてるのかもしれません。defaults read com.apple.finder の出力後に、command + I で"WindowBounds"を検索してみてください。


「com.apple.finder.plist」の理解を進める、良き方法は、ないでしょうか?

私は、デフォルトの設定から変更したことや、アイコンサイズ、接続したデバイスの情報、その他諸々の情報を記録しているファイルと理解してます。 この記録された情報に基づいて利便性が保たれていると。


現状、ウィンドウの位置及びサイズは、WindowBoundsに記録されてるようだけど、自動で設定してくれないみたいだから手動で設定するとどうなるのか? といったところでしょうか?


追記

Xcode、インストールしましょう。Xcodeで見る方がKeyの入れ子やValueのイメージが理解しやすいのではないかと。 内蔵ストレージの容量的に厳しいのなら、外付けのデバイスからでも動くはずなので、外付けHDDやSDカードにでも保存しておけば必要に応じて各plistが見れるようになります。 ただし、セキュリティー面で外付けのデバイスに入れづらいかもしれないので、その時は...........確認してないので..............

2018/04/23 20:31 スカイブルー193 への返信

> 複数使用するときは、command+Nで、2つ目以降を出します。


そこは、command+tにしましょう。(理由は後ほど書きます)


> 「Finderウインドウを中央上から左上へ移動し即閉じる」をして、どこの数値が、変わるのかを見てみます。

> 変化した数値の箇所は、無いように見えます。


その通りです。com.apple.finder.plistに登録されているのは、特殊なフォルダー等のWindowBoundsだけなのでした。


> Finderウインドウの「WindowBounds」は、どれなのでしょうか?


デフォルトのWindowBounds(画面中央やや上)を変更することはできません。

それでは、WindowBoundsはどこに記録されているのでしょうか?


1. Finderからフォルダーを作成した場合


Finderメニュー→Go→Desktopでウインドウを開き、ウインドウのサイズと位置を好きなように調整します。

ウインドウの中に、"Folder"という名前のフォルダーを作り、ダブルクリックして"Folder"に移動します。

次に、"SubFolder"という名前のフォルダーを作り、ダブルクリックして"SubFolder"に移動します。


ウインドウを閉じた後、Finderメニュー→Go→Recent Foldersに"Folder"と"SubFolder"が登録されているのでそれぞれ開いてみます。デスクトップと同じWindowBoundsで開きます。何故でしょうか?


Terminalで、"ls -al ~/Desktop/Folder"と打つと".DS_Store"というファイルが出来ていることがわかります。ここに、"SubFolder"のWindowBoundsが保存されています。("Folder"のWindowBoundsは~/Desktop/.DS_Storeに保存されています。)


ウインドウを閉じた後、Terminalで、"rm ~/Desktop/Folder/.DS_Store && killall Finder"と打ち削除します。


Finderメニュー→Go→Recent Folders→SubFolderを開くと、画面中央やや上に表示されます。つまり、"SubFolder"のWindowBoundsの設定が消されたことがわかります。


2. Finder以外からフォルダーを作成した場合


前回作った"Folder"を削除します。


Terminalで、"mkdir ~/Desktop/Folder ~/Desktop/Folder/SubFolder"と打ちフォルダーを作ります。デスクトップの"Folder"をダブルクリックして開きます。画面中央やや上に表示されます。


ウインドウを閉じた後、Finderメニュー→Go→Desktopでウインドウを開き、"Folder"と"SubFolder"へ順に移動します。ウインドウを閉じた後、Finderメニュー→Go→Recent FoldersからFolder"と"SubFolder"を開くと、デスクトップと同じWindowBoundsで開きます。


Finderでダブルクリックして移動した時点で、WindowBoundsが受け継がれる(".DS_Store"が作成/更新される)ということがお判りいただけたと思います。


そこで、常にウインドウを開いておき(邪魔なときは閉じずに最小化する)、2つ以上のウインドウが必要な場合、command+tでタブを開くようにすれば、同じWindowBoundsとなります。ファイルのコピーや移動は、タブのタイトル部分にドラッグします。


加えて、常に複数タブを開いて運用すれば、ReopenStateが登録されます。何故ならばどのタブの".DS_Store"を使えばよいか判断つかないので別の仕組みが必要となるためです。つまり、ReopenStateのWindowBoundsがいつも使われることになり、各フォルダーの".DS_Store"に悩まされずに済みます。


> 多発するので、毎回直すのは、面倒なので、大きさを決められたら、楽だなぁ~なのですが、

> 直らなくても、大問題では無いので、仕方ないなぁ~と、受け入れられるものではあります。


新規フォルダー以外で多発するのであれば、もしかするとディスクがおかしくなっているかもしれません。

起動時にcommand+rを押してリカバリーボリュームから起動して、Disk UtilityでFirst Aidしてみて下さい。


デフォルトのWindowBounds(画面中央やや上)に戻ってしまうのは特定のフォルダー(特定のパス)ですか?それともランダムですか?

2018/05/10 17:05 hohokihai への返信

hohokihai さんによる書き込み:


".DS_Store"はフォルダーウインドウのサイズや位置、表示方法、ビューオプションなどを変更した時点で自動生成・更新されます。まあ、幾つものフォルダーの設定を変更しなおすのは面倒ですけど...


これで治ったと思います。

現在、自分で決めたウインドウの大きさで、「新規Finderウインドウ」が、毎回、出てきてくれています。

小さな(多分デフォルトの)大きさの、「新規Finderウインドウ」は、その後、見てないです。



ーーーーーーーーーー

hohokihai 様。 onesize 様。 青リンゴ 様。 お子様ランチ. 様。 kai_markII 様。


みなさまのおかげで、症状の沈静化が、出来ました。

出なくなると、寂しいなどと申すつもりはありませんが、そのくらい、静かに感じるほどです。

いちいち、大きさ直していたのが、無くなるのが、こんなにも、心地よいとは\(^o^)/


ほんとうに、みなさまのおかげです。

ここまで、大きくお導きくださり、誠にありがとうございました。感謝申し上げます。


また、ターミナルで、いくつかのコマンドを、することできたので、おおいに、勉強になりました。

重ねて、感謝申し上げます。



ほんとうに、ありがとうございましたm(_ _)m

このスレッドはシステム、またはAppleコミュニティチームによってロックされました。 問題解決の参考になる情報であれば、どの投稿にでも投票いただけます。またコミュニティで他の回答を検索することもできます。

Finderのウインドウを、決めた大きさで、毎回、開きたい

Apple サポートコミュニティへようこそ
Apple ユーザ同士でお使いの製品について助け合うフォーラムです。Apple Account を使ってご参加ください。